Key refurbishment figures for 2024
The global refurbishment market represents over €65 billion and shows annual growth of 15%, demonstrating the scale of this economic transformation.
This growing trend reflects a collective awareness of the need to reduce our ecological footprint and promote a sustainable circular economy.
Refurbishment involves restoring used products to give them a second life, which helps reduce waste and preserve natural resources.

The most dynamic sectors in refurbishment include:
| Sector | 2024 Growth | Market Share | Future Potential |
|---|---|---|---|
| Electronics | +22% | 45% | Very high |
| Automotive | +18% | 25% | High |
| Home appliances | +15% | 12% | High |
| Furniture | +12% | 10% | Moderate |
| Fashion | +25% | 8% | Very high |
Each of these sectors benefits from technological innovation and growing demand for durable and affordable products.

Critical environmental impact
Each year, 54 million tons of electronic waste are generated globally. Refurbishment allows 85% of this equipment to be diverted from landfills.
Consumers are increasingly aware of the environmental impact of disposable electronics. Refurbishment extends product lifespan and reduces electronic waste.
This approach thus directly contributes to an efficient circular economy.

Refurbished spare parts market
The European refurbished auto parts market represents €8.5 billion in 2024, with annual growth of 12%.
Refurbished spare parts offer a cost-effective and ecological solution:
- Refurbished engines with extended warranty
- Transmissions restored to manufacturer standards
- Refurbished electronic systems
- Renovated body components
This reduces waste and extends vehicle lifespan. Additionally, these practices contribute to the green economy by measurably reducing carbon footprint.

Positive environmental impact
Home appliance refurbishment prevents the emission of 2.3 tons of CO2 per refurbished appliance and saves 75% of resources needed for new manufacturing.
Recycling materials used in appliances reduces the amount of waste sent to landfills. This approach promotes an efficient and sustainable circular economy.

Textile environmental impact
The textile industry generates 92 million tons of waste annually. Refurbished fashion can reduce this impact by 70% according to sector experts.
